Advanced and proven gel technology
Unlike conventional wet or AGM batteries, a gel battery has the electrolyte thickened in a silica gel. This completely prevents leakage and eliminates the need to top up with water. The gel technology offers excellent resistance to vibrations, very low self-discharge and above all outstanding tolerance to deep discharges. This makes them the safest and most durable choice for intensive supply applications.

FAQs about the MK Gel Battery M22NFSLDG
What does "Deep Cycle" mean?
"Deep Cycle" means that the battery is designed to regularly discharge a large part of its stored energy (deep discharge) and then be fully recharged without rapidly losing capacity. This is crucial for supply applications, as opposed to starter batteries, which only deliver high currents briefly.
What is the main difference between gel and AGM batteries?
Both are maintenance-free non-woven batteries. In gel batteries, however, the electrolyte is thickened to a gel consistency, whereas in AGM batteries it is bound as a liquid in a glass fibre mat. Gel batteries generally offer even higher cycle stability and better tolerance to deep discharges, making them the premium solution for the most demanding supply applications.
Which charger do I need for this gel battery?
You need a modern, microprocessor-controlled charger that has a special charging characteristic for gel batteries. The charging voltage for gel batteries is usually somewhat lower than for AGM or wet batteries. Using the wrong charger can significantly shorten the service life of the battery.
Can I connect two of these batteries in series to get 24V?
Yes, this is a very common application, especially in electric vehicles, wheelchairs or for 24V solar systems. To ensure optimum performance and service life, always use two identical batteries (same model, same capacity) which ideally come from the same production batch and have the same state of charge.
How must this lead battery be disposed of?
Lead batteries contain environmentally harmful substances and must not be disposed of in household waste. You can return your old battery to any retailer selling new batteries or to local recycling centres free of charge to ensure proper recycling.
